How they compare
Marshall Islands currently reports 1.01 million const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re against 885,391 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in Spain, a difference of 121,399 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Marshall Islands's figure about 1.1 times Spain's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 20 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Marshall Islands ahead.
Marshall Islands ranks 42nd and Spain ranks 44th of 169 countries.
Marshall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Imports of goods and services (constant 2015 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
